Aperol Spritz

Recipe

Ingredients

  • · 3 parts of Prosecco D.O.C. (3oz)
  • · 2 parts of Aperol (2oz)
  • · 1 splash of soda (1oz)
  • · 1 slice of orange

Preparation

  1. Place ice cubes in a stemmed wine glass.
  2. Pour 3 parts of Prosecco D.O.C. (3oz).
  3. Follow by pouring 2 parts of Aperol (2oz), and 1 ounce of soda (1oz).
  4. Garnish with a slice of orange and stir.
